# Riju
|
|
|
|
Riju is a very fast online playground for every programming language.
|
|
In less than a second, you can start playing with a Python interpreter
|
|
or compiling [INTERCAL](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/INTERCAL) code.
|
|
|
|
Check it out at the <https://riju.codes>!

## Is it free?
|
|
|
|
Riju is free and always will be free for everyone.
|
|
|
|
However, if Riju gets popular enough, I won't be able to afford paying
|
|
for the hosting myself. To help me keep Riju online, you can donate
|
|
via Patreon. All donations are used solely to cover hosting costs, and
|
|
any surplus is donated to the [Electronic Frontier
|
|
Foundation](https://www.eff.org/).

## Is it safe?
|
|
|
|
Riju does not collect your personal information.
|
|
|
|
* Your code is deleted from the server as soon as you close Riju.
|
|
* Your terminal input and output is never saved or logged anywhere.
|
|
* Riju uses [Fathom Analytics](https://usefathom.com/) to measure
|
|
traffic. Fathom collects very limited data and does not sell it to
|
|
third parties, unlike Google Analytics.
|
|
* Riju does not serve advertisements.
|
|
|
|
All of the above notwithstanding, any service that allows people to
|
|
run code online is inherently risky. For this reason, I can't make any
|
|
guarantees about the security or privacy of your data.
